Linking Policies for Public Web Sites
URL: http://www.llrx.com/features/internetwaves.htm

Description:
A fascinating and vital article for librarians creating Web sites that link to others. Starting with problems the Clearwater Public Library (Florida) had with another Web site creator, this author, a librarian and Web manager, describes the importance of having a linking policy, gives several resources on policy creation, and describes several current controversies over linking. She cautions that "in our notoriously litigious society ... you need to have more than a passing familiarity with this stuff."
